10 sets of questions journalists should ask themselves

 (1) What do I know? What do I need to know?

(2) What is my journalistic purpose? 

(3) What are my ethical concerns? 

(4) What organizational policies and professional guidelines should I consider? 

(5) Can I include other people, with different perspectives and diverse ideas, in the decision-making process? 

(6) Who are the stakeholders—those affected by my decision? What are their motivations? Which are legitimate?

(7) What if the roles were reversed? How would I feel if I were in the shoes of one of the stakeholders?

(8) What are the possible consequences of my actions? Short-term? Long-term? 

(9) What are my alternatives to maximize my truth-telling responsibility and minimize harm? 

(10) Can I clearly and fully justify my thinking and my decision? To my colleagues? To the stakeholders? To the public?


Reference:
Shoemaker, P. J. & Reese, S. D. (1996, p.100-101). Mediating The Message: Theories of Influences on Mass Media Content. USA: Longman.
